Output 94a329b189b9d94edfa40cd8ae65a8b58b0a063c251ab66794952c9954191c62:1

value
19691160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f11dfcd5764300ab4c4c8e1b48cec6d74c76700 OP_EQUALVERIFY OP_CHECKSIG
address
13qHMsT2zibZ5CX2qQEL6EsVDULSBDwWTX
transaction
94a329b189b9d94edfa40cd8ae65a8b58b0a063c251ab66794952c9954191c62
confirmations
578695
spent
true